Recognizing Rheumatology: When to Look for a Professional
Rheumatology is a branch of internal medicine dedicated to the medical diagnosis and therapy of rheumatic conditions. These problems often influence the joints, muscle mass, bones, tendons, tendons, and connective cells. Unlike orthopedic specialists that focus on surgical treatments for bone and joint problems, rheumatologists are professionals in non-surgical management, making use of drugs, treatments, and lifestyle alterations to relieve pain, lower inflammation, and enhance general function.
You might take into consideration getting in touch with a rheumatologist if you experience any one of the following:
Persistent joint discomfort, stiffness, or swelling: Particularly if it impacts several joints or lasts for greater than a couple of weeks.
Early morning rigidity: Rigidity that lasts for more than half an hour upon waking.
Limited variety of activity: Problem relocating your joints completely.
Muscle weakness or pain: Unusual muscle pains or exhaustion.
Symptoms of autoimmune conditions: Such as skin breakouts, fatigue, fever, or completely dry eyes and mouth, which can be connected with conditions like lupus or rheumatoid joint inflammation.
A medical diagnosis of joint inflammation: Including osteo arthritis, rheumatoid joint inflammation, psoriatic joint inflammation, or gout arthritis.
Connective tissue conditions: Such as scleroderma or Sjogren's syndrome.
Vasculitis: Inflammation of blood vessels.
Looking for prompt examination from a rheumatologist can result in an precise diagnosis and the growth of a personalized treatment strategy to handle your condition efficiently.

The Significance of Consulting with Arthritis and Rheumatology Consultants
Whether you are in Sugar Land or Houston, looking for advice from skilled joint inflammation and rheumatology consultants is vital. These professionals bring a wealth of expertise and scientific expertise to the table, making certain exact diagnoses and the development of reliable monitoring methods.
Arthritis & rheumatology experts work collaboratively with clients to understand their certain symptoms, medical history, and way of living, producing personalized therapy strategies that might include:
Medicines: Including disease-modifying antirheumatic medications (DMARDs), biologics, n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ory medicines (NSAIDs), and corticosteroids.
Physical and work-related therapy: To improve stamina, versatility, and function.
Injections: Such as joint injections or nerve obstructs to relieve pain and inflammation.
Way of life adjustments: Consisting of exercise, diet regimen, and stress administration strategies.
Individual education: Empowering people to comprehend their problem and actively join their care.

Finding the Right Rheumatologist: Secret Considerations
Selecting the best rheumatologist is a individual decision, and a number of elements must be considered:
Board Certification: Guarantee your rheumatologist is board-certified in rheumatology, suggesting they have satisfied rigorous criteria of training and expertise.
Experience: Take into consideration the rheumatologist's experience in treating your certain condition.
Hospital Affiliations: If you have complex clinical demands, take into consideration a rheumatologist associated with a trustworthy health center or clinical facility.
Insurance Policy Coverage: Verify that the rheumatologist approves your insurance coverage plan.
Communication Style: Select a rheumatologist who communicates clearly, pays attention to your concerns, and entails you in the decision-making process.
Area and Availability: Take into consideration the benefit of the center's location, whether in sugar land rheumatology clinics or rheumatologist houston offices.
Client Testimonials and Recommendations: Read on-line testimonials and ask your medical care doctor for suggestions.
